Start function enables the Tx Adapter to start enqueueing packets to the Tx queue. Stop function stops the Tx Adapter from transmitting any mbufs to the Tx queue. The Tx Adapter also frees any mbufs that it may have buffered for this queue. All inflight packets destined to the queue are freed until the queue is started again.
